Job Description
Design and model industrial machinery parts & assemblies of tools utilizing 2D detail drawings and 3D CAD software.
What You'll Be Doing
- Perform material selections
- Consider heat treatment requirements and purchasing parts like pneumatic cylinders, clamps, bearings, balancers, etc. as required
- Collaborate with Project Manager to implement customized mechanical designs of Tools and Fixtures
- Review specifications and other data to develop mechanical layouts
- Analyze engineering designs for implementations into new/existing systems
- Prepare drawings for production using GD & T standards
- Plan work-flow, Attend meetings, conduct statistical studies, Line-up controls engineering
- Identify & implement new manufacturing technologies or processes
Requirements
- A Master's degree in Mechanical Engineering
